   8  /**
   9   * Scale down the default size of an image.
  10   *
  11   * This is so that the image is a better fit for the editor and theme.
  12   *
  13   * The $size parameter accepts either an array or a string. The supported string
  14   * values are 'thumb' or 'thumbnail' for the given thumbnail size or defaults at
  15   * 128 width and 96 height in pixels. Also supported for the string value is
  16   * 'medium' and 'full'. The 'full' isn't actually supported, but any value other
  17   * than the supported will result in the content_width size or 500 if that is
  18   * not set.
  19   *
  20   * Finally, there is a filter named, 'editor_max_image_size' that will be called
  21   * on the calculated array for width and height, respectively. The second
  22   * parameter will be the value that was in the $size parameter. The returned
  23   * type for the hook is an array with the width as the first element and the
  24   * height as the second element.
  25   *
  26   * @since 2.5.0
  27   * @uses wp_constrain_dimensions() This function passes the widths and the heights.
  28   *
  29   * @param int $width Width of the image
  30   * @param int $height Height of the image
  31   * @param string|array $size Size of what the result image should be.
  32   * @return array Width and height of what the result image should resize to.
  33   */
  34  function image_constrain_size_for_editor($width, $height, $size = 'medium') {
  35      global $content_width;
  36  
  37      if ( is_array($size) ) {
  38          $max_width = $size[0];
  39          $max_height = $size[1];
  40      }
  41      elseif ( $size == 'thumb' || $size == 'thumbnail' ) {
  42          $max_width = intval(get_option('thumbnail_size_w'));
  43          $max_height = intval(get_option('thumbnail_size_h'));
  44          // last chance thumbnail size defaults
  45          if ( !$max_width && !$max_height ) {
  46              $max_width = 128;
  47              $max_height = 96;
  48          }
  49      }
  50      elseif ( $size == 'medium' ) {
  51          $max_width = intval(get_option('medium_size_w'));
  52          $max_height = intval(get_option('medium_size_h'));
  53          // if no width is set, default to the theme content width if available
  54      }
  55      elseif ( $size == 'large' ) {
  56          // we're inserting a large size image into the editor.  if it's a really
  57          // big image we'll scale it down to fit reasonably within the editor
  58          // itself, and within the theme's content width if it's known.  the user
  59          // can resize it in the editor if they wish.
  60          $max_width = intval(get_option('large_size_w'));
  61          $max_height = intval(get_option('large_size_h'));
  62          if ( intval($content_width) > 0 )
  63              $max_width = min( intval($content_width), $max_width );
  64      }
  65      // $size == 'full' has no constraint
  66      else {
  67          $max_width = $width;
  68          $max_height = $height;
  69      }
  70  
  71      list( $max_width, $max_height ) = apply_filters( 'editor_max_image_size', array( $max_width, $max_height ), $size );
  72  
  73      return wp_constrain_dimensions( $width, $height, $max_width, $max_height );
  74  }

 245  
 246  /**
 247   * Retrieve calculated resized dimensions for use in imagecopyresampled().
 248   *
 249   * Calculate dimensions and coordinates for a resized image that fits within a
 250   * specified width and height. If $crop is true, the largest matching central
 251   * portion of the image will be cropped out and resized to the required size.
 252   *
 253   * @since 2.5.0
 254   *
 255   * @param int $orig_w Original width.
 256   * @param int $orig_h Original height.
 257   * @param int $dest_w New width.
 258   * @param int $dest_h New height.
 259   * @param bool $crop Optional, default is false. Whether to crop image or resize.
 260   * @return bool|array False, on failure. Returned array matches parameters for imagecopyresampled() PHP function.
 261   */
 262  function image_resize_dimensions($orig_w, $orig_h, $dest_w, $dest_h, $crop=false) {
 263  
 264      if ($orig_w <= 0 || $orig_h <= 0)
 265          return false;
 266      // at least one of dest_w or dest_h must be specific
 267      if ($dest_w <= 0 && $dest_h <= 0)
 268          return false;
 269  
 270      if ( $crop ) {
 271          // crop the largest possible portion of the original image that we can size to $dest_w x $dest_h
 272          $aspect_ratio = $orig_w / $orig_h;
 273          $new_w = min($dest_w, $orig_w);
 274          $new_h = min($dest_h, $orig_h);
 275          if (!$new_w) {
 276              $new_w = intval($new_h * $aspect_ratio);
 277          }
 278          if (!$new_h) {
 279              $new_h = intval($new_w / $aspect_ratio);
 280          }
 281  
 282          $size_ratio = max($new_w / $orig_w, $new_h / $orig_h);
 283  
 284          $crop_w = ceil($new_w / $size_ratio);
 285          $crop_h = ceil($new_h / $size_ratio);
 286  
 287          $s_x = floor(($orig_w - $crop_w)/2);
 288          $s_y = floor(($orig_h - $crop_h)/2);
 289      }
 290      else {
 291          // don't crop, just resize using $dest_w x $dest_h as a maximum bounding box
 292          $crop_w = $orig_w;
 293          $crop_h = $orig_h;
 294  
 295          $s_x = 0;
 296          $s_y = 0;
 297  
 298          list( $new_w, $new_h ) = wp_constrain_dimensions( $orig_w, $orig_h, $dest_w, $dest_h );
 299      }
 300  
 301      // if the resulting image would be the same size or larger we don't want to resize it
 302      if ($new_w >= $orig_w && $new_h >= $orig_h)
 303          return false;
 304  
 305      // the return array matches the parameters to imagecopyresampled()
 306      // int dst_x, int dst_y, int src_x, int src_y, int dst_w, int dst_h, int src_w, int src_h
 307      return array(0, 0, $s_x, $s_y, $new_w, $new_h, $crop_w, $crop_h);
 308  
 309  }
 310  
 311  /**
 312   * Scale down an image to fit a particular size and save a new copy of the image.
 313   *
 314   * The PNG transparency will be preserved using the function, as well as the
 315   * image type. If the file going in is PNG, then the resized image is going to
 316   * be PNG. The only supported image types are PNG, GIF, and JPEG.
 317   *
 318   * Some functionality requires API to exist, so some PHP version may lose out
 319   * support. This is not the fault of WordPress (where functionality is
 320   * downgraded, not actual defects), but of your PHP version.
 321   *
 322   * @since 2.5.0
 323   *
 324   * @param string $file Image file path.
 325   * @param int $max_w Maximum width to resize to.
 326   * @param int $max_h Maximum height to resize to.
 327   * @param bool $crop Optional. Whether to crop image or resize.
 328   * @param string $suffix Optional. File Suffix.
 329   * @param string $dest_path Optional. New image file path.
 330   * @param int $jpeg_quality Optional, default is 90. Image quality percentage.
 331   * @return mixed WP_Error on failure. String with new destination path. Array of dimensions from {@link image_resize_dimensions()}
 332   */
 333  function image_resize( $file, $max_w, $max_h, $crop=false, $suffix=null, $dest_path=null, $jpeg_quality=90) {
 334  
 335      $image = wp_load_image( $file );
 336      if ( !is_resource( $image ) )
 337          return new WP_Error('error_loading_image', $image);
 338  
 339      list($orig_w, $orig_h, $orig_type) = getimagesize( $file );
 340      $dims = image_resize_dimensions($orig_w, $orig_h, $max_w, $max_h, $crop);
 341      if (!$dims)
 342          return $dims;
 343      list($dst_x, $dst_y, $src_x, $src_y, $dst_w, $dst_h, $src_w, $src_h) = $dims;
 344  
 345      $newimage = imagecreatetruecolor( $dst_w, $dst_h);
 346  
 347      // preserve PNG transparency
 348      if ( IMAGETYPE_PNG == $orig_type && function_exists( 'imagealphablending' ) && function_exists( 'imagesavealpha' ) ) {
 349          imagealphablending( $newimage, false);
 350          imagesavealpha( $newimage, true);
 351      }
 352  
 353      imagecopyresampled( $newimage, $image, $dst_x, $dst_y, $src_x, $src_y, $dst_w, $dst_h, $src_w, $src_h);
 354  
 355      // we don't need the original in memory anymore
 356      imagedestroy( $image );
 357  
 358      // $suffix will be appended to the destination filename, just before the extension
 359      if ( !$suffix )
 360          $suffix = "{$dst_w}x{$dst_h}";
 361  
 362      $info = pathinfo($file);
 363      $dir = $info['dirname'];
 364      $ext = $info['extension'];
 365      $name = basename($file, ".{$ext}");
 366      if ( !is_null($dest_path) and $_dest_path = realpath($dest_path) )
 367          $dir = $_dest_path;
 368      $destfilename = "{$dir}/{$name}-{$suffix}.{$ext}";
 369  
 370      if ( $orig_type == IMAGETYPE_GIF ) {
 371          if (!imagegif( $newimage, $destfilename ) )
 372              return new WP_Error('resize_path_invalid', __( 'Resize path invalid' ));
 373      }
 374      elseif ( $orig_type == IMAGETYPE_PNG ) {
 375          if (!imagepng( $newimage, $destfilename ) )
 376              return new WP_Error('resize_path_invalid', __( 'Resize path invalid' ));
 377      }
 378      else {
 379          // all other formats are converted to jpg
 380          $destfilename = "{$dir}/{$name}-{$suffix}.jpg";
 381          if (!imagejpeg( $newimage, $destfilename, apply_filters( 'jpeg_quality', $jpeg_quality ) ) )
 382              return new WP_Error('resize_path_invalid', __( 'Resize path invalid' ));
 383      }
 384  
 385      imagedestroy( $newimage );
 386  
 387      // Set correct file permissions
 388      $stat = stat( dirname( $destfilename ));
 389      $perms = $stat['mode'] & 0000666; //same permissions as parent folder, strip off the executable bits
 390      @ chmod( $destfilename, $perms );
 391  
 392      return $destfilename;
 393  }
